Which is more reliable, Sugra or Twelve Data?
On our scheduled checks, Twelve Data leads on measured uptime — Sugra at 98.0% versus Twelve Data at 99.02% over 90 days. These are our own probe results, not provider claims; the uptime bars above show the day-by-day record for both.
Which is faster, Sugra or Twelve Data?
Twelve Data has the lower median latency in our checks — Sugra responds in 775 ms versus Twelve Data at 253 ms (P50). Tail latency (P95) is in the table above; for most workloads the median is the number that shapes how the API feels.

Can I call Sugra and Twelve Data from the browser?
Only Twelve Data is browser-friendly — it returns CORS headers over HTTPS. Sugra needs a server-side call or proxy, so factor that into which one fits a front-end project.
